Block

#18,804,892
Block Number
18,804,892 @ 06/11/2024, 04:34:10
Status
Finalized
ID
0x011ef09cf9b768303e02e6571a9a27510b59bcb04d4f8c98dc6f87c2d4169076
Transactions
Gas Used
205115/40000000 (0.51% Used)
Total Score
157,819,131 (+14)
Rewards
1.09 VTHO